Trang web tĩnh Ưu điểm của chúng là gì?

Trang web tĩnh

Theo dõi với sự liệt kê của chúng tôi của các công cụ mã nguồn mở hữu ích cho các doanh nhân, chúng tôi sẽ dành bài viết tiếp theo cho các trình tạo trang web tĩnh. Tuy nhiên, cách giải thích tính hữu ích của nó thì hơi phức tạp, Chúng tôi sẽ dành một bài đăng để giải thích sự khác biệt của nó với các trình quản lý nội dung truyền thống và lợi thế của nó là gì.

Tôi bắt đầu bằng cách làm rõ rằng tôi hoàn toàn không chống lại các nhà quản lý nội dung truyền thống. Trên thực tế, tôi sử dụng chúng hàng ngày. Trên thực tế, nếu bạn đang bắt tay vào một dự án kinh doanh với ngân sách hạn hẹp và có nhiều việc phải tham gia cùng một lúc, bạn có thể nên sử dụng chúng.

Trang web tĩnh Chúng là gì?

Khi chúng ta nói về một trang web tĩnh, chúng ta không nên nghĩ đến những trang web đó từ những ngày đầu của Internet, trong đó chỉ có các trang cố định với văn bản và hình ảnh bất động. Ý chúng tôi là máy chủ không thực hiện bất kỳ sửa đổi nào đối với trang web trước khi hiển thị nó. Mọi thay đổi đều được thực hiện bởi trình duyệt trên thiết bị khách thực thi mã Javascript.

Hãy để tôi làm rõ điều này với một ví dụ.

Linux Adictos, giống như hàng triệu trang web khác trên khắp thế giới, sử dụng trình quản lý nội dung có tên là WordPress. Cơ sở mã WordPress hoàn toàn giống nhau trên tất cả các trang web sử dụng cùng một phiên bản.

Mỗi khi bạn vào cổng, Máy chủ tham khảo cơ sở dữ liệu nội dung nó có để hiển thị cho bạn. Nội dung đó chính là điều tạo nên sự khác biệt Linux Adictos của những chiếc xe gây nghiện hoặc những loại vải gây nghiện. Trong cùng một cơ sở dữ liệu đó là thông tin về nội dung bạn có quyền truy cập tùy thuộc vào loại người dùng của bạn và cách thông tin được hiển thị tùy thuộc vào loại thiết bị đích.

Ưu điểm của trang web tĩnh

Ít tài nguyên hơn

Để chạy trình quản lý nội dung điển hình, bạn cần:

  • Một máy chạy hệ điều hành.
  • Máy chủ web chạy Apache, Ngnix hoặc tương tự.
  • Cài đặt và cấu hình PHP và các phần mở rộng của nó đúng cách.
  • Một công cụ cơ sở dữ liệu được hỗ trợ.
  • Người quản lý nội dung đã chọn.
  • Tất cả các tiện ích bổ sung và chủ đề bổ sung mà bạn cần.

Bạn có thể tin tôi rằng để tất cả những điều này hoạt động hài hòa là một nhiệm vụ xứng đáng của một kẻ tung hứng. Quyết định bạn phải đưa ra là bạn tự làm hay bạn trả tiền cho người khác để làm điều đó. Có máy chủ web giá rẻ và máy chủ web tốt. Không có cái nào đáp ứng cả hai điều kiện. Và, ngay cả khi nhà cung cấp dịch vụ lưu trữ của bạn quan tâm đến việc cập nhật và hoạt động 5 yếu tố đầu tiên, khả năng plugin hoặc chủ đề phá vỡ điều gì đó vẫn tiềm ẩn.

Các trang web tĩnh (từng được tạo ra bởi một trình tạo) không hơn gì các tệp HTML, CSS và Javascript, do đó chúng không cần quá nhiều thứ để hoạt động. Bạn thậm chí có thể chọn tự lưu trữ chúng trên Raspberry Pi.

Tính linh hoạt

Trình quản lý nội dung truyền thống có khả năng định cấu hình cao và có hàng trăm tiện ích bổ sung cho phép họ làm hầu hết mọi thứ. Nhưng, bạn mất rất nhiều thời gian để loại bỏ những gì bạn không cần. Và, các tiện ích bổ sung thú vị nhất được trả phí (và khá đắt)

Với trình tạo trang web tĩnh, bạn có thể tạo trang web chỉ với những gì bạn cần và dễ dàng sửa đổi khi cần

Tốc độ

Như tôi đã giải thích ở đầu bài viết, một trang web tĩnh chỉ là HTML, bảng định kiểu và mã Javascript. Máy chủ không thực hiện bất kỳ sửa đổi nào trước khi hiển thị để nó tải nhanh hơn.

An ninh

Vấn đề với các nhà quản lý nội dung phổ biến nhất chính là ở chỗ, chúng rất phổ biến. Với hàng trăm nghìn dòng mã, bạn rất dễ mắc lỗi. Và, những lỗi đó được khai thác bởi tội phạm mạng.

Điều quan trọng là phải ghi nhớ điều này. Một trang web không cần phải nổi tiếng để trở thành nạn nhân của tội phạm mạng. Nhiều năm trước, lợi dụng lỗ hổng trong trình quản lý nội dung, họ đã sử dụng một trong những trang web của tôi để đánh lừa khách hàng của một ngân hàng Bắc Mỹ.

Nói cách khác, bạn phải đảm bảo rằng hoàn toàn tất cả các thành phần mà chúng tôi đề cập ở trên đều được cập nhật (và cầu nguyện rằng các nhà phát triển sẽ phát hiện ra các lỗ hổng trước khi bọn tội phạm)

Không thể đưa mã độc hại vào các trang web tĩnh vì chúng được tạo trên máy sản xuất trước khi tải lên. Trình tạo tạo tệp HTML phẳng với CSS và JavaScript. Khi người dùng yêu cầu một trang từ trang web của bạn, máy chủ chỉ gửi cho họ tệp cho trang đó mà không cần phải xây dựng lại nó.

Cũng không thể sửa đổi cơ sở dữ liệu vì chúng không được sử dụng.


Để lại bình luận của bạn

địa chỉ email của bạn sẽ không được công bố. Các trường bắt buộc được đánh dấu bằng *

*

*

  1. Chịu trách nhiệm về dữ liệu: AB Internet Networks 2008 SL
  2. Mục đích của dữ liệu: Kiểm soát SPAM, quản lý bình luận.
  3. Hợp pháp: Sự đồng ý của bạn
  4. Truyền thông dữ liệu: Dữ liệu sẽ không được thông báo cho các bên thứ ba trừ khi có nghĩa vụ pháp lý.
  5. Lưu trữ dữ liệu: Cơ sở dữ liệu do Occentus Networks (EU) lưu trữ
  6. Quyền: Bất cứ lúc nào bạn có thể giới hạn, khôi phục và xóa thông tin của mình.

  1.   Delio Orozco Gonzalez dijo

    Các trang web tĩnh cũng hữu ích khi bạn muốn phân phối thông tin trong môi trường mà kết nối chậm hoặc không tồn tại. Ví dụ, phiên bản di động của Wikipedia đáp ứng yêu cầu này; Nói cách khác, nó cung cấp thông tin và kiến ​​thức mà không cần kết nối Internet.

    1.    Diego người Đức Gonzalez dijo

      Cám ơn bạn đã góp ý. Đóng góp tốt

  2.   dai dijo

    Gần đây tôi đã thử nghiệm với Bashblog nhưng đối với tôi dường như tài liệu tồn tại là rất ít ...

    Với Pelican, tôi đã làm tốt hơn nhưng điều tôi nghĩ cần thiết là những bài hát ngày càng hay hơn, hầu hết những bài đã rất cũ.

    1.    Diego người Đức Gonzalez dijo

      Cảm ơn vì bạn đã phản hồi